I had to share these BTS sills from a David Fincher movie I worked on last year. The movie is called "Mank", about the screenwriter for Citizen Kane.
This movie was so much fun to work on. All the political posters and signage was created by me along with a number of other things. David's still guy, Miles Crist, is the absolute best. The photos are incredible.

This new model I designed looks simple, but it is quite complicated. Not only for designing, but also for the tinkering kids at home. Hours of crafting fun guaranteed!
The Municipality of Amsterdam is improving the crossings between Noord and the rest of the city with a swing bridge for cyclists and pedestrians over the Noordhollandsch Kanaal.
This model was designed commissioned by the infrastructure builder of the bridge and is handed out as a promotional gift. The size is 14 x 4.5 inch.- that looks anything but simplehans_glib

Finally, today, I finished my quarantine project. I began with this in May 2020.
I had photographed a cheesy photo last year and had the idea to turn it into a so-called diamond painting, then frame it and photograph it hanging on a wall.
A diamond painting basically is a sticky paper where you glue thousands of small plastic diamonds on. The paper says where to glue which color, so it is all about patience, only.
But it requires a lot of patience. I glued more or less 32,000 pieces to finish this 40x50cm artwork. This took me around 100 hours in total.
Was it worth it? Certainly not. But I remembered the QBN quote 'Never don't give up' and so I finished this off.
I would like to point out that the woman originally had nothing between her legs. Nothing red, I mean. The diamond painting has 33 colors (why 33, I wondered) and either they have no skin tones in their plastic palette or they produced this as 'safe for work' (= censored my uploaded photo). I still finished it and will see if I can tweak the colors when photographing the framed version.
Very satisfied this is finally away from our dining table.
